2003 Ford Crown Victoria vs. 2004 Peugeot 607
To start off, 2004 Peugeot 607 is newer by 1 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2003 Ford Crown Victoria.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2003 Ford Crown Victoria would be higher. At 4,601 cc (8 cylinders), 2003 Ford Crown Victoria is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2003 Ford Crown Victoria (221 HP @ 4800 RPM) has 65 more horse power than 2004 Peugeot 607. (156 HP @ 5650 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2003 Ford Crown Victoria should accelerate faster than 2004 Peugeot 607.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2003 Ford Crown Victoria weights approximately 247 kg more than 2004 Peugeot 607.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2003 Ford Crown Victoria is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2003 Ford Crown Victoria.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2004 Peugeot 607,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2003 Ford Crown Victoria (361 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 144 more torque (in Nm) than 2004 Peugeot 607. (217 Nm @ 3900 RPM). This means 2003 Ford Crown Victoria will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2004 Peugeot 607.
Compare all specifications:
2003 Ford Crown Victoria | 2004 Peugeot 607 | |
Make | Ford | Peugeot |
Model | Crown Victoria | 607 |
Year Released | 2003 | 2004 |
Body Type | Sedan |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 4601 cc | 2230 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 221 HP | 156 HP |
Engine RPM | 4800 RPM | 5650 RPM |
Torque | 361 Nm | 217 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4000 RPM | 3900 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 90.2 mm | 86 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 90 mm | 96 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 9.4:1 | 10.8: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line - Premium |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1777 kg | 1530 kg |
Vehicle Length | 5390 mm | 4880 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1990 mm | 1830 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1450 mm | 1470 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2620 mm | 2730 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 11.8 L/100km | 9.4 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 75 L | 80 L |
